TUSCALOOSA, Ala. -- Beginning two hours before kickoff of select
home football games, The University of Alabama will offer Game
Day University where UA faculty members will give interesting presentations
to alumni and fans at the Bryant Conference Center.
On Saturday, Oct. 1, before the UA vs. Florida football game,
Debra Morrison, director of the coordinated program in human dietetics
in the UA College of Human Environmental
Sciences, will present “Obesity
DEFENSE-Punt the Pounds!” In this interactive session, Morrison
will present healthy and effective eating habits for lifelong weight
management and risk reduction for diseases such as high blood pressure
and diabetes.
The lecture is offered at no cost, reservations are not needed,
and refreshments will be served.
Game Day University is sponsored by the Bryant Conference Center
and the UA Colleges
of Continuing Studies, Arts
and Sciences, Commerce
and Business Administration and Human
Environmental Sciences.
